Ingredients List
- 12 oz Pasta (any type will work, I usually go for penne or rotini for the best bite!)
- 2 cups Rotisserie chicken (shredded, the store-bought kind saves so much time!)
- 2 cups Broccoli florets (fresh or frozen, whatever you have on hand)
- 1/4 cup Olive oil (this really enhances the flavor, trust me!)
- 1 tsp Garlic powder (this adds that wonderful aroma and taste)
How to Prepare Rotisserie Chicken and Broccoli Pasta
Cooking the Pasta
First things first, let’s get that pasta cooking! Bring a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. Add your pasta and cook according to the package instructions, usually around 8-10 minutes for al dente perfection. Make sure to stir occasionally to prevent sticking. Once it’s done, drain the pasta and set it aside while we work on the rest of the dish.
Sautéing Broccoli
Now, let’s move on to the broccoli! In a skillet, pour in the olive oil and heat it over medium heat. Once the oil is shimmering, toss in the broccoli florets. Sauté them for about 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they’re bright green and tender but still have a nice crunch. You’ll love the aroma that fills your kitchen as the broccoli cooks! If you’re using frozen broccoli, it may take a minute or two longer, so keep an eye on it and stir to ensure even cooking.
Combining Ingredients
Once your broccoli is perfectly sautéed, it’s time for the star of the show—our shredded rotisserie chicken! Add it to the skillet along with the garlic powder. Stir everything together and let it heat through for about 2-3 minutes. You want that chicken warmed up and the garlic to infuse all the flavors! Finally, toss the cooked pasta into the skillet with the chicken and broccoli mixture. Gently mix everything together until well combined, and voilà! You’ve got a vibrant, satisfying dish ready to serve.

Tips for Success
To make your Rotisserie Chicken and Broccoli Pasta truly shine, here are a few pro tips! First, don’t skimp on the seasoning—feel free to add a pinch of salt and pepper to taste while sautéing the broccoli. If you’re a cheese lover like me, sprinkle some grated Parmesan or mozzarella on top before serving for that extra creaminess! For a little kick, try adding red pepper flakes to the chicken and broccoli mixture. And if you want to pack in more veggies, throw in some diced bell peppers or spinach. Storage & Reheating Instructions
To store your leftover Rotisserie Chicken and Broccoli Pasta, let it c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It will keep in the fridge for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ply reheat in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of olive oil or water to keep it moist. You can also microwave it in short intervals, stirring in between!
FAQ Section
Q1. Can I use leftover rotisserie chicken for this recipe?
Absolutely! Using leftover rotisserie chicken makes this dish even quicker and adds fantastic flavor.
Q2. What type of pasta works best?
Any pasta will do! I love using penne or rotini, but feel free to choose your favorite shape.
Q3. Can I add other vegetables?
You bet! This recipe is so versatile—diced bell peppers, spinach, or even peas can mix in beautifully.
Q4. How can I make this dish vegetarian?
Simply swap the rotisserie chicken for chickpeas or a meat alternative, and you’ll still enjoy a hearty meal!
Q5. Is this dish freezer-friendly?
Yes! You can freeze the pasta for up to a month. Just be sure to cool it completely before storing in airtight containers.
